I had to go to Tyler yesterday for work and would advise not to go until Sunday due to the roads. If you have to go take your patience the roads were just horrible yesterday and what thawed yesterday froze over night. I took the toll rd 45 to 69 and 49 was 20 mph all the way to 69 once on 69 it wasn’t any better and the loop 323 was the same. When I left there was a grater on 49 but nothing being done on 69. Also there were a lot of traffic lights out with stop signs put up which made the intersections fun. As far as 20 when I left at 6 Pm it was great both directions and was able to do 70 mph.
